
Filipendula ulmaria
Common Name: 'Meadowsweet'This native wildflower forms vigorous clumps with pinnately divided leaves and has fluffy heads of sweetly scented, creamy-white flowers. Jun-Jul. H90cm S60cm.

Care Instructions
Grow in fertile, humus-rich, moist but well-drained or poorly-drained soil in full sun or partial shade. Good for naturalizing in damp grass. Associates well with Lythrums.
